Judith "Judy" Annette Fox (nee: Stephens), passed away on April 4, 2025 at the age of 84.
Judy was born February 2, 1941 in St Louis, MO, daughter of Marvin "Steve" and Marie (Romines) Stephens. Judy graduated from Wellston High School and was voted Best Athlete in her class, playing softball, basketball, volleyball and bowling.
Judy married her husband, Robert "Bob" Fox in September 1961. They were married 50 years prior to Bob's passing in 2011. Together, they owned and operated Bob's Transmission and Automotive Service in Maryland Heights since 1989.
Judy is survived by her daughters, Cindy (Tim) Fox-Griffey of Dardenne Prairie, MO and Jodie (Craig) Triplett of Wentzville, MO; 12 grandchildren, Vince (Danielle), Stacy (Brannan), Brian (Viral), Melissa (Connor), Adam (Hannah), Samantha (Zach), Jacob (Emma), Connor (Sarah), Robbie, Taylor (Katie), Aubree and Dustin; and 12 great grandchildren.
Along with her parents, Judy is preceded in death by her husband, Bob Fox; her boyfriend of 10 years, Jabo Jablonowski, and son, Rob Fox.
Judy loved spending time with her family and was an active Mother and Grandmother. Summers were spent in the pool, at Six Flags, Eckerts, Grant's Farm, fishing, gardening or vacationing. She enjoyed sports when she was younger playing softball, racquetball, volleyball and bowling. She was a fan of the St Louis Rams and St Louis Cardinals. She will be remembered for her strength, kindness, attention to detail, her bright blue eyes, beautiful smile and love for her family. She will be missed dearly.
